Output 51db9926f3012b4d70b6a5c61e7be943fcc92b334e59406f7f8ce67596b1723d:0

value
2967942
script pubkey
OP_0 OP_PUSHBYTES_20 deb43f834adf956e86038cb16bcbad47c26cbe9d
address
bc1qm66rlq62m72kapsr3jckhjadglpxe05ad8c0an
transaction
51db9926f3012b4d70b6a5c61e7be943fcc92b334e59406f7f8ce67596b1723d
confirmations
58705
spent
true